Looking for warm weather? Then head to Gettysburg in July, when the average temperature is 73.4 °F, and the highest can go up to 86 °F. The coldest month, on the other hand, is January, when it can get as cold as 23 °F, with an average temperature of 30.2 °F. You’re likely to see more rain in May, when precipitation is around 3.9″. In contrast, February is usually the driest month of the year in Gettysburg, with an average rainfall of 2.8″.

How to Get to Gettysburg

Plane

Although Gettysburg doesn’t have its own airport, you can fly to Hagerstown Regional (HGR), which is located 28 miles from Gettysburg. The shortest domestic flight to Gettysburg departs from Atlanta and takes around 1h 40m.

Train

Amtrak is the most popular train carrier serving Gettysburg, followed by Acela. The train journey from Gettysburg to Richmond takes 1h 56m and costs around $19 for a one-way ticket. When coming by train from Philadelphia, expect to pay about $11 for a 1h 57m trip.

Car

Another option to get to Gettysburg is to pick up a car rental from New York, which is about 182 miles from Gettysburg. You’ll find branches of Turo and Drive Tri-State, among others, in New York.

Bus

Several bus lines operate bus routes to Gettysburg, including Peter Pan Bus Lines, Washington Deluxe and Bus. From New York, the bus ride to Gettysburg takes 265 miles and will cost you around $36. From Hartford, the ticket costs about $38 for a journey of 450 miles.
